Patty Gerstenblith is Distinguished Research Professor at DePaul University College of Law. She is Director of DePaul’s Center in Art, Museum and Cultural Heritage Law and Co-Vice Chair of the American Bar Association’s International Art and Cultural Heritage Law Committee. She served as Editor-in-Chief of the International Journal of Cultural Property from 1995 to 2002 and as a public representative on the President’s Cultural Property Advisory Committee from 2000 to 2003. Her book, Art, Cultural Heritage and the Law, was published in 2004 with a second edition in 2008. She received her J.D. from Northwestern University and a Ph.D. from Harvard University in Fine Art and Anthropology. Before joining DePaul, she served as a clerk to the Honorable Richard D. Cudahy of the Seventh Circuit Court of Appeals.
